WebDec 10, 2024 · Weight loss is also a sign of pheochromocytoma and occurs because of a catecholamine-induced hypermetabolic state. In a study of 360 patients with pheochromocytomas and paragangliomas, Krumeich et al. 10 showed that norepinephrine and normetanephrine levels were inversely associated with weight.
